The Power of "Crazy in Love"
"Crazy in Love" isn't just any song; it's a cultural phenomenon. Released in 2003 as part of Beyoncé's debut solo album, Dangerously in Love, it immediately shot to the top of the charts and became an instant classic. The infectious beat, the killer horn section, and Beyoncé's powerhouse vocals create a sonic explosion that's impossible to resist. But it's more than just a catchy tune. The song's themes of passionate love and vulnerability resonate deeply with listeners, making it a timeless favorite. For many, it's the ultimate expression of being head-over-heels for someone.
